Walter Reuther was president of the United Auto Workers from 1946 until he died in a plane crash in 1970. For him, the UAW was a movement and an instrument for social change.

Walter Reuther was instrumental in organizing the strike against General Motors, demanding the right to unionize, better wages, and safe working conditions.
